Perimeter is the sum of the lengths of all sides on any given shape. In this case, we know that since the triangle is isosceles, two sides must be the same (in a triangle, two of the same angles will produce two of the same sides opposite of the angles). However, there can not be two 2 inch long sides. Think of this logically; If you had two sides of 2 inches connected to a 5 inch long side, no matter what angle you pull those 2 inch sides down, the maximum it could reach is close to their cumulative sum, or around 4 inches. Since 4 inches isn't long enough to reach above 5 inches, then the only possibility for the side lengths is 5 inches + 5 inches + 2 inches. Thus, the perimeter is 12 inches.

You can view a kite as 4 triangles
Step-by-step explanation:
A geometric kite can easily be viewed as 4 triangles. The formula to calculate the area of a kite (width x height)/2 is very similar to the one of a triangle (base x height)/2.
According to the formula to calculate the area of a kite, we would get:
(36 x 30)/2 = 540.
If we take the approach of using 4 triangles, we could imagine a shape formed by 4 triangles measuring 18 inches wide with a height of 15.
The area of each triangle would then be: (18 x 15)/2 = 135
If we multiply this 135 by 4... we get 540.
Answer:
equation of line is:
y = -2x - 6
Explanation:
The general form of the line is:
y = mx + c
where:
m is the slope of the line
c is the y-intercept
(a) getting the slope of the line:
slope of the line is calculated using the following rule:
slope of line (m) = (y2-y1) / (x2-x1) = (-24--12) / (9-3) = -2
The equation now becomes:
y = -2x + c
(b) getting the y-intercept:
The two given points belong to the line. Therefore, to get the y-intercept, we will use one of the points and substitute in the equation and solve for c.
I will use the point (3,-12)
y = mx + c
-12 = -2(3) + c
-12 = -6 + c
c = -12 + 6
c = -6
Based on the above, the equation of the line is:
y = -2x - 6
